Web6 de dez. de 2024 · North American porcupine predators include fishers (carnivores in the weasel family), coyotes, wolves, bobcats and cougars. In addition, predatory birds such as eagles and owls prey on porcupines. The fisher is one of the few animals able to get past the porcupine’s formidable defences. Web12 de set. de 2024 · The belly and lower legs contain no quills. North American porcupines have short legs and well-developed claws. Porcupines have poor eyesight, but exceptional senses of hearing and smelling. The average length from head to tail is 26-39 inches. On average, porcupines weigh 15 to 40 pounds.
